Rare system cane from the former collection of Madeleine Gely. In Paris.
This cane is the one Madeleine Gely lent to Catherine Dike to be photographed and described in her reference book, "Les cannes à système, un monde fabuleux et méconnu", illustration 7 / 104.
This is a chain system that drove the stone wheel. The flint was held in place by a spring-loaded blade. The wick was adjusted by a ring that moved it forward or backward, it was protected by a small cover with a pretty bee motif. On the top of the pommel a bird and flowers very representative of the motifs depicted around 1900.
Missing the wick and the screw thread on the "lid" is slightly off (visible on the photos).
The entire cane measures 35,63 inches long.
France, late 19th /1900.
